      Key Features

      • Multi-Channel Monitoring: Supports [e.g., 2 to 64, expandable] independent input channels, allowing simultaneous monitoring of multiple locations and gas types from a single, centralized unit.
      • Universal Sensor Compatibility: Engineered to integrate with a diverse range of industry-standard gas sensors, including:
        • 4-20mA Analog Sensors: For both wired and wireless transmitters.
        • Modbus RTU/TCP Sensors: For intelligent digital communication and advanced diagnostics.
        • mV Bridge Sensors: For specific catalytic bead or electrochemical sensor types.
      • Intuitive User Interface: Features a [e.g., large 7-inch color touchscreen LCD] display with clear graphics and easy-to-navigate menus, providing real-time gas concentrations, alarm statuses, and system diagnostics at a glance.
      • Multi-Stage Alarm Configuration: Offers fully customizable alarm levels (e.g., Low, High, Critical/Evacuate, Fault) for each channel, with independent latching/non-latching options and configurable delays to minimize false alarms.
      • Robust Relay Outputs: Equipped with [e.g., 4 to 16 programmable dry contact relays] for activating external devices such as:
        • Audible alarms (sirens, horns)
        • Visual alarms (strobes, warning lights)
        • Ventilation systems
        • Automatic shut-off valves
        • Building Management Systems (BMS) / SCADA
      • Comprehensive Data Logging: Onboard memory stores historical gas concentration data, alarm events, and fault logs with time and date stamps, crucial for compliance, incident investigation, and trend analysis.
      • Self-Diagnostic Capabilities: Continuously monitors its own operational health, including sensor connectivity, power supply, and internal components, alerting operators to potential faults before they compromise safety.
      • Advanced Communication Protocols:
        • RS-485 Modbus RTU/TCP: For seamless integration with existing PLCs, DCS, and SCADA systems.
        • Ethernet Connectivity (Optional): Enables remote monitoring, configuration, and data access over a local network or internet.
        • Remote Annunciator Support: Connect to remote display units for critical information dissemination across larger facilities.
      • Durable & Reliable Design: Housed in an industrial-grade [e.g., NEMA 4X / IP66 rated] enclosure, providing superior protection against dust, water, and corrosive environments.
      • Expandability & Modularity: Designed for future growth, allowing for easy expansion of input channels and integration of new sensor technologies.
